Good news, this is fixed by 50ea3135e0948a042cd3b899e970f6ade291a0c2! As noted in the commit log, this issue stemmed from a change in #:autoload semantics in Guile 3.0. In 3.0, the line: #:autoload (gcrypt hash) (port-sha256) means that only ‘port-sha256’ is imported. Conversely, in 2.2 (which is the Guile version used by the ‘compute-guix-derivation’ program above), that #:autoload line means that all the (gcrypt hash) bindings are imported. That includes the ‘sha256’ bindings, which would thus prevent matching the ‘sha256’ literal in the ‘origin-compatibility-helper’ macro. Terrible! Ludo’.
